book-2, chapter-19, verse-5
अकारणैः कारणिभिर्बोधार्थमुपमीयते ।
उपमानैस्तूपमेयैः सदृशैरेकदेशतः ॥ ५ ॥

For the sake of understanding, something is compared by means of causes and non-causes. However, it is also partially likened through similar analogies to the objects of comparison.
Words meanings summery:
(Scroll down for elaborated words morphology)
- अकारणैः (akāraṇaiḥ) - by non-causes, by uncaused ones
- कारणिभिः (kāraṇibhiḥ) - by causes, by causal agents
- बोधार्थम् (bodhārtham) - for the sake of understanding, for comprehension
- उपमीयते (upamīyate) - is compared, is likened
- उपमानैः (upamānaiḥ) - by comparisons, by similes, by standards of comparison
- तु (tu) - but, however, on the other hand
- उपमेयैः (upameyaiḥ) - by things to be compared, by objects of comparison
- सदृशैः (sadṛśaiḥ) - by similar ones, by likes
- एकदेशतः (ekadeśataḥ) - partially, in one part, in some respects
